Maximizing Your Certified Nursing Assistant Earnings in Amherst Town
Within Amherst Town, senior certified nursing assistants who seek to elevate their pay can pursue specialized roles that command higher salaries, such as restorative aides, medication aides, and those qualified in dementia care or hospice services. Compensation across various sectors also tends to differ; experienced professionals in skilled nursing facilities or hospitals may earn higher salaries compared to those in home health agencies or assisted living communities. Additionally, advancement paths such as charge CNA roles or transitioning into LPN or RN positions enable further lucrative opportunities. Senior-level position seekers might benefit from certifications like CPR/BLS and medication aide designations, which not only expand skill sets but also enhance marketability. Factors like shift differentials for nights and weekends, agency premium pay during staffing shortages, and specialty training stipends further boost earnings, making the field an attractive option for dedicated practitioners in the nursing workforce.
